Security System Supplier Services in Pinetown, KwaZulu-Natal
In Pinetown, KwaZulu-Natal, security system suppliers provide a range of solutions designed to protect homes, small businesses, and larger enterprises. The offerings typically combine assessment, installation, and ongoing support to create tailored protection plans. Local installers recognise the climate, architectural styles, and urban layout of the area, which influence the choice of technologies and installation strategies. Clients can expect a consultative process that considers risk exposure, entry points, and existing infrastructure before recommending equipment and services.
Common service categories include the supply of burglary and intruder alarms, access control systems, video surveillance, and perimeter protection. Intruder alarms may feature external proofing such as shock sensors and glass-break detectors, along with internal motion sensors. Access control encompasses keyless entry, biometric readers, and card or fob systems for sites ranging from domestic residences to small offices. Video surveillance typically combines high-definition cameras with remote viewing capabilities and recording solutions, enabling monitoring from on-site or mobile devices. Perimeter protection often involves fence detection, beam sensors, and lighting automation to deter intruders and assist in rapid response.
Beyond hardware, security system suppliers in Pinetown commonly offer design, installation, commissioning, and maintenance services. The initial assessment focuses on risk, layout, and connectivity considerations, followed by the installation of cabling, power supplies, control panels, and software interfaces. Commissioning ensures that sensors communicate correctly with the control unit, that alerts trigger as intended, and that recording systems operate reliably. Maintenance plans may cover routine testing, firmware updates, battery replacements, and on-call support to address faults promptly. Technical support is frequently available during business hours, with escalation options for urgent incidents.

Practical considerations for prospective customers include the following:
- Site assessment: A thorough survey identifies vulnerable entry points, necessary sensors, and optimal camera placement to maximise coverage while minimising blind spots.
- Scalability: Systems are often designed to accommodate future expansion, such as additional cameras, access points, or upgraded alarm features as security needs evolve.
- Power and connectivity: Reliable power supply and network access are critical; options commonly include mains power with battery backups and Ethernet or wireless connectivity for cameras and control panels.
- Data and monitoring: Decisions about on-site recording versus remote viewing influence storage requirements, bandwidth usage, and response times during incidents.
- Maintenance and response: Routine servicing, system health checks, and clear service level agreements help ensure devices operate effectively and that incidents are addressed promptly.
- Cost considerations: Investment typically reflects the sophistication of the system, the number of devices, and the level of ongoing support, with flexible options to match different budgets.
